Constraints and the evolution of egg size and juvenile size in amniotes
Kubát, Jan ; Kratochvíl, Lukáš (advisor) ; Hořák, David (referee)
Amniotes (mammals, reptiles including birds) exhibit wide diversity in egg/offspring size relatively to female body size. This study reviews mechanisms determining size of propagules (such as morphological or physiological constraints, trade-off between size versus number etc.). Particular attention is paid to comparison of allometric relationship in egg/offspring size among individual amniotic lineages.
Photoelectric transport in high resistivity CdTe
Kubát, Jan ; Franc, Jan (advisor) ; Šikula, Josef (referee) ; Oswald, Jiří (referee)
Title: Photoelectric transport in high resistivity CdTe Author: Ing. RNDr. Jan Kubát Institute: Institute of Physics of Charles University Supervisor: Doc. Ing. Jan Franc, DrSc. Supervisor's e-mail address: jan.franc@mff.cuni.cz Abstract: CdTe is one of the most promising material for fabrication of X-ray and gamma ray detectors. Despite a considerable effort invested in material development there are still problems remain to be solved and influence efficiency of charge collection. We focus on study of polarization of the sample due to space charge accumulated on deep levels in this work. Samples of CdTe doped with Cl, Sn, In and Ge were investigated. Measurements of spectral dependence of photocurrent and lux- ampere characteristics were done. We performed mathematical modeling of measured data using an approach based on a three level compensation model, and solution of drift-diffusion and Poisson equations. Concentration of deep levels 1011 -1013 cm-3 was revealed in semiinsulating CdTe by modeling. Contact method measurement for determination of µτ product using I-A characteristics and Hecht relation was applied. Photoelectric spectroscopy of deep elekctronic levels in high-resistance CdTe
Kubát, Jan
CdTe is one of the most interesting X-ray and g-ray detectors' material. This work deals with influence of deep levels to photoelectric properties of CdTe. PICTS, Lux-Ampere and spectral dependences measurements at room temperature and low temperature 10K were performed on one undoped and several variously doped (Cl, Sn and Ge) samples and applied electrical fields up to 800V.cm-1. Experimental setups are introduced. Room temperature numerical solution of sample photoelectrical properties for typical midgap level using driftdiffusion and Poisson equation was performed and results are discussed. The experimentally observed slopes of Lux-ampere characteristics and energy shifts of the main photoconductivity peak with the applied voltage are explained based on a model of screening of electric field by charge accumulated on deep levels. Finally comparison with acquired experimental data is performed yielding estimates of maximum total concentration of deep levels in the samples.

NEW ON THE „OLD“ – Brno, Bratislavská - Stará Corner
Kubát, Jan ; Uřídilová, Marcela (referee) ; Pelčák, Petr (advisor)
Design of corner house, a block of flats in the deprived neighborhood near the centre of the city. It is situated on the crossing of Bratislavská and Stará street. The parterre is used by a co-working centre and by small pastry and book shop. The parterre draws the line between rush streets and still court, which serves to residents. House noninvasively complements existing structures and brings the impulse for change. The proposal also addresses the urban and social outreach.

Harmonic Pattern Share Analysis
Kubát, Jan ; Musílek, Petr (advisor) ; Havlíček, David (referee)
The aim of this work is to test harmonic chart patterns on europen and american stock markets. The logic of classical chart patterns is based on behavioral psychology. In the year 1997, Larry Pesavento introduced harmonic chart patterns in his book "Fibonacci Ratios with Pattern Recognition" [1]. Harmonic chart patterns contain ratios based on fibonacci principle. Fibonacci principle is not based in behavioral psychology, it is based in natural law. Harmonic patterns are the first chart patterns, that are not based in behavioral psychology. The main goal of this work is to answer two questions: Is strategy based on harmonic chart patterns more profitable that pasive portfolio strategy? Are the harmonic chart patterns more profitable than the classical chart patterns?
Electricity market model of the Czech Republic
Kubát, Jan ; Pelikán, Jan (advisor) ; Kodera, Jan (referee) ; Marvan, Miroslav (referee)
A competitive electricity market has been established in many European countries including the Czech Republic. The electricity market includes a limited number of significant producers and traders, which can be described by oligopoly model. Since the electricity transmission and distribution are regulated, I consider two types of players performing in the electricity market: producers of electricity and traders, who buy electricity from producers and sell it to final customers. I derive oligopoly model with producers and traders "a la Cournot" and calculate a formula of equilibrium strategies. I use these theoretical findings to build a dynamic oligopoly model Ele. Ele is formulated as a mixed complementary problem and calibrated on data for the Czech Republic and neighbor states for several scenarios. The model was specified and calculated in GAMS software by the PATH solver. The results represent a Nash equilibrium. That means for individual producers: electricity generation, investment in new power plants construction and emission permits purchases. For traders the results are: equilibrium purchases, sales and cross-border transfers of electricity in each particular time period. Ele derives also equilibrium regional wholesale and retail electricity prices, emission permit prices and prices of cross-border auctions. Ele results point to an economic profitability of new nuclear power plants constructions. Further, I formulate a game in short-term electricity market, where I advise to Czech market participants, subjects of settlement, how much and in which circumstances to buy or sell electricity. Equilibrium results obtained through simulations based on the principle of a fictive game show that the current payment system of imbalance in the Czech Republic does not increase the risk of instability of electricity networks.
Technical analysis in the Intraday Trading
Kubát, Jan ; Veselá, Jitka (advisor)
The aim of this work is to create "Intraday concept", that could be used as a manual for amateur intraday traders to achieve systematic approach in the intraday trading. First part of this work defines general rules for intraday trading. Second part chooses technical indicatiors for intraday use. In the last part of this work are presented automatic trading systems and "Intraday koncept" is created on the basis of data gained in previous chapters.
